Mr Fawcett graduated from Charing Cross and Westminster Medical School in 1989. Following his house officer year he completed a junior surgical trainee rotation in North West Thames, obtaining his Fellowship of the Royal College of Surgeons of England in 1993. Mr Fawcett then undertook a period of research at Charing Cross Hospital, studying the influence of microvascular disease on colonic anastomotic healing, publishing a variety of papers on microvascular disease and its causes, culminating in a dissertation for which a Masters degree was awarded by the University of London.

On returning to clinical surgery, he completed his registrar training, rotating through West Middlesex University Hospital, Charing Cross and Chelsea and Westminster, before obtaining his CCST in 2000. He then worked at one of the UK’s foremost hospitals for colorectal disease, St Mark’s, initially as an RSO for six months and then for a little over a year as a locum consultant also covering the Central Middlesex Hospital, before taking up his current Consultant appointment at Kingston Hospital in 2002.
